The PFSK162 3BSE015088R1 signal conditioning board is a device designed to process multiple signal inputs, and it is capable of conditioning, converting, enhancing or suppressing the signal to meet the needs of a specific application. The following is a detailed explanation of the signal regulator board:
Main functions:
Signal amplification: PFSK162 3BSE015088R1 amplifies the input signal to increase the amplitude and strength of the signal.
Signal filtering: The signal is screened through a filter to remove noise and interference components and retain useful signals.
Signal conversion: The input signal is converted into other forms or formats to adapt to different system and equipment requirements.
Signal adjustment: The frequency, phase, amplitude and other parameters of the signal are adjusted to meet specific signal processing requirements.
Design features:
Multi-port design: The PFSK162 3BSE015088R1 signal regulator usually adopts a multi-port design, which can process multiple signals at the same time, improving the processing efficiency.
Widely used in many fields: Due to its diversity and flexibility of functions, signal regulating boards are widely used in various industrial, scientific research and communication fields.
